java后端服务器部署

作者:侯叔瑜 | 发布日期:2024-06-17 07:49:26



后端服务器是任何基于 Web 的应用程序的基础,它负责处理数据、业务逻辑并生成响应。 服务器部署涉及将应用程序代码和配置部署到服务器,以便应用程序可以处理请求并提供服务。
部署选项
有不同的服务器部署选项,包括:
本地部署:应用程序部署在本地计算机上,仅供本地访问。
云部署:应用程序部署在云平台(例如 AWS 或 Azure)上,可以从任何地方访问。
容器化部署:应用程序打包在容器中,可以在不同平台上轻松部署和运行。
部署步骤
服务器部署过程通常涉及以下步骤:
服务器配置:配置服务器操作系统、网络设置和其他必要组件。
代码部署:将应用程序代码和依赖项部署到服务器。
数据库配置:如果应用程序需要数据库,则需要配置数据库并建立连接。
服务配置:配置应用程序的 Web 服务或应用程序服务器。
测试和调试:测试和调试应用程序以确保其正常运行。
监控和维护
一旦部署服务器,就需要定期监控和维护以确保其高效运行。 这包括:
性能监控:监控服务器的资源使用情况(例如 CPU、内存)和响应时间。
日志记录和错误处理:记录应用程序错误并实施有效的错误处理机制。
安全更新:定期应用安全补丁和更新以保护服务器免受漏洞侵害。
备份和恢复:定期备份应用程序数据和配置以防止数据丢失。